The fee structure for the Chemistry program at Birla Institute Of Applied Sciences is designed to be transparent, fair, and aligned with the quality of education provided. The total cost for four years includes tuition fees, hostel charges, mess advance, and other mandatory expenses.
| Component | Semester-wise Cost (INR) |
|---|---|
| Tuition Fee | 300000 |
| Hostel Rent | 25000 |
| Mess Advance | 40000 |
| Student Benevolent Fund | 1000 |
| Medical Fees | 2000 |
| Gymkhana Fees | 500 |
| Examination Fees | 2000 |
| Total Annual Cost | 376500 |
Birla Institute Of Applied Sciences offers modern, comfortable hostels for students. The hostel facilities include single occupancy rooms, shared bathrooms, common study areas, and 24/7 security services.
The mess billing system is based on a prepayment model where students pay a fixed amount at the beginning of each semester. Meals are served daily, and any excess or deficit is adjusted accordingly at the end of the semester.
Students can avail rebates for various reasons such as attending special events, participating in competitions, or being absent due to valid medical reasons. Rebates are calculated based on the duration of absence and the applicable rate per day.
The institute offers several financial assistance programs for deserving students:
Scholarships are available for students scoring above a certain threshold in qualifying examinations. These scholarships range from INR 50,000 to INR 1,00,000 per year and are awarded based on merit and financial need.
Payments must be made within the specified deadlines to avoid late fees and penalties. The institute accepts payments through online banking, credit/debit cards, and NEFT/RTGS transfers.
A late fee of INR 500 per day is charged for delayed payments beyond the due date. For amounts exceeding INR 10,000, an additional penalty of 2% per month may be applied.
If a student withdraws from the program, a refund of the remaining balance will be processed after deducting administrative charges and any applicable penalties. Refunds are issued within 30 working days of receiving the withdrawal request.
